应用对象
Windows Server 2012 Datacenter Windows Server 2012 Datacenter Windows Server 2012 Standard Windows Server 2012 Standard Windows Server 2012 Essentials Windows Server 2012 Foundation Windows Server 2012 Foundation Windows Server 2008 R2 Service Pack 1 Windows Server 2008 R2 Datacenter Windows Server 2008 R2 Enterprise Windows Server 2008 R2 for Itanium-Based Systems Windows Server 2008 R2 Foundation Windows Server 2008 R2 Standard Windows Server 2008 R2 Web Edition

症状

Microsoft 分布式事务处理协调器 (MSDTC) 服务可能正在运行 Windows Server 2012 或 Windows 服务器 2008 R2 Service Pack 1 (SP1) 的计算机上意外停止。此外,是在应用程序日志中记录下列事件之一︰

原因

此问题是由于不能正确处理的内部结构。

解决方案

若要解决此问题,在 Windows Server 2012,安装累积更新 2984005。若要解决此问题,Windows Server 2008 R2 SP1 中的,安装在"修补程序信息"一节中介绍的修复程序。

更新信息

有关如何获取此更新总成包的详细信息,请单击下面的文章编号,以查看 Microsoft 知识库中相应的文章:

2984005 9 月 2014年累积更新 Windows RT、 Windows 8 和 Windows Server 2012

修补程序信息

可以从 Microsoft 获得受支持的修复程序。然而,此修补程序仅用于解决本文中描述的问题。此修复程序仅适用于遇到本文中描述的问题的系统。此修补程序可能会接受进一步的测试。因此,如果这个问题没有对您造成严重的影响,我们建议您等待包含此修复程序的下一个软件更新。如果此修复程序可供下载,则在此知识库文章的顶部会出现“修补程序下载可用”部分。如果未显示此部分,请与 Microsoft 客户服务和支持部门联系以获取此修复程序。注意:如果出现其他问题或需要任何故障诊断时,您可能需要创建单独的服务请求。对于不符合此特定的修补程序的其他支持问题和事项将照常收取费用。有关 Microsoft 客户服务和支持电话号码的完整列表,或要创建单独的服务请求,请访问下面的 Microsoft 网站:

http://support.microsoft.com/contactus/?ws=support注意:"提供修补程序下载"窗体显示获取此修复程序的语言。如果看不到您的语言,则修补程序没有那种语言的版本。

系统必备组件

要应用此修补程序,您必须在运行 Windows Server 2008 R2 SP1。有关如何获取 Windows 7 或 Windows Server 2008 R2 Service Pack 的详细信息,请单击下面的文章编号,以查看 Microsoft 知识库中相应的文章:

976932Windows 7 和 Windows Server 2008 R2 服务包1 的信息

注册表信息

若要应用此修补程序,您不必对注册表进行任何更改。

重启要求

应用此修补程序后,必须重新启动分布式事务处理协调器 (MSDTC) 服务。

修补程序替换信息

此修补程序不替代以前发布的修补程序。

此修复程序的全球版本将安装具有下表所列属性的文件。这些文件的日期和时间以协调世界时 (UTC) 列出。您的本地计算机上这些文件的日期和时间以您的本地时间加上当前夏令时 (DST) 偏差显示。此外,当您对文件执行某些操作时,日期和时间可能会更改。

Windows Server 2008 R2 文件信息的备注

  • 通过检查下表中显示的文件版本号,可以识别应用于特定产品、 SR_Level (RTM、 SPn) 和服务分支 (LDR、 GDR) 的文件:

    版本

    产品

    里程碑

    服务分支

    6.1.760 1.22xxx

    Windows Server 2008 R2

    SP1

    LDR

  • 为每个环境所安装的 MANIFEST文件 (.manifest) 和MUM (.mum) 文件都在" Windows Server 2008 R2 附加文件的信息"部分中被单独列出。MUM 和 MANIFEST 文件以及关联的安全目录 (.cat) 文件,对于维护更新组件的状态极为重要。对其属性没有列出的安全目录文件已签署 Microsoft 数字签名。

对于所有受支持的基于 x64 的 Windows Server 2008 R2 版本

文件名称

文件版本

文件大小

日期

时间

平台

Msdtctm.dll

2001.12.8531.22369

1,511,936

26-Jun-2013

09:38

x64

对于所有受支持的基于 IA-64 的 Windows Server 2008 R2 版本

文件名称

文件版本

文件大小

日期

时间

平台

Msdtctm.dll

2001.12.8531.22369

2,868,736

26-Jun-2013

09:36

IA-64

解决方法

若要变通解决此问题,请使用名"NoTracking"以及值为 1,HKLM\Software\Microsoft\MSDTC 注册表项下创建 DWORD 注册表值。然后,重新启动 MSDTC 服务。注意:如果您使用此替代方法来变通解决此问题,则分配的交易记录的信息不会显示在组件服务应用程序的用户界面 (UI) 中。因此,不能解决分配的"不确定"状态的交易记录。这些事务可能导致在数据库服务器分发一次事务锁定问题。

状态

Microsoft 已经确认这是“适用于”一节中列出的 Microsoft 产品中的问题。

详细信息

有关软件更新术语的详细信息,请单击下面的文章编号,以查看 Microsoft 知识库中相应的文章:

824684用来描述 Microsoft 软件更新的标准术语的说明

Windows Server 2008 R2 的其他文件信息

所有受支持的基于 x64 版本的 Windows Server 2008 R2 的附加文件

文件名称

Amd64_421f1b22674738afc8b5e0748ddc62dd_31bf3856ad364e35_6.1.7601.22369_none_cccd714ee4e7e197.manifest

文件版本

不适用

文件大小

710

日期(UTC)

27-Jun-2013

时间 (UTC)

06:47

平台

不适用

文件名称

Amd64_microsoft-windows-com-dtc-runtime-tm_31bf3856ad364e35_6.1.7601.22369_none_f81705b84aa13921.manifest

文件版本

不适用

文件大小

31,494

日期(UTC)

26-Jun-2013

时间 (UTC)

10:12

平台

不适用

对于所有受支持基于 IA-64 的版本的 Windows Server 2008 R2 的附加文件

文件名称

Ia64_21b4519a8bcd09f2341616c941b48955_31bf3856ad364e35_6.1.7601.22369_none_71bfdc902f248844.manifest

文件版本

不适用

文件大小

708

日期(UTC)

27-Jun-2013

时间 (UTC)

06:47

平台

不适用

文件名称

Ia64_microsoft-windows-com-dtc-runtime-tm_31bf3856ad364e35_6.1.7601.22369_none_9bfa0e2a9241d0e7.manifest

文件版本

不适用

文件大小

31,493

日期(UTC)

26-Jun-2013

时间 (UTC)

10:05

平台

不适用

需要更多帮助?

需要更多选项?

了解订阅权益、浏览培训课程、了解如何保护设备等。